Rep-Cal 52298 is a phosphorous-free calcium powder supplement designed specifically for reptiles and amphibians. Manufactured in the USA, this 4.1 oz powder is vet-recommended and formulated to provide balanced, complete nutrition that supports strong bones and overall vitality without the need for additional supplements.

Panther Chameleon Calcium to Phosphorus Ratio approved
I started using this when the other Calcium I was using by Flukers seemed to be triggering edema in my Panther Chameleons. The edema went away within a few weeks of switching to this formula and they became active again. The average cricket has a ratio of Calcium to Phosphorus that's 1:30. Panther Chams should be fed a ration of Calcium to Phosphorus that's 2:1. So You need to double the Calcium essentially (or more) while not adding any further Phosphorus because it's already too high. Using a Calcium formula that doesn't contain Phosphorus allows you to achieve a correct Calcium to Phosphorus ratio using the Phosphorus% of the feeder to balance it out. TLDR: If you have Panther Chameleons exhibiting edema and you have ruled out other causes besides the Calcium supplement - try this.
